One of our favorite men about town, DJ/producer/ fellah-who-inspires-envy Mark Ronson is an old school sneaker head. Last year at the invitation of Gucci’s creative director Frida Giannnini, Ronson attended a men’s show in Milan.
“I loved the clothes,” Ronson recalls. “I loved the aesthetic, it’s quite like the streamline of mod, the cut, but all the prints were a bit more bright and it kind of had this 80s reinvented new wave to it. After the show we went to the headquarters, like the coolest sort of weird Bond villain lair you can imagine. She told me this idea to do a
collaboration, something that mixed in music which is an important part for me, since I’m not a clothing designer. like it has to have some component of music or it doesn’t make sense, so for the next few months we kicked around ideas.”
The result of their collaboration is a line of shoes co-designed by the pair. You can purchase the fruit of their intense labors at the Gucci Icon-Temporary Store, a traveling pop-up that has just touched down in NYC. Customers get a fr
ee 12” produced by Mark Ronson, too!
As a footnote, the VMAN editor used to hear Mr. Ronson DJ the hip-hop room at raves in the early 90s under the moniker Spark Ronson.
